About the Kia Ev6

The Kia EV6 is a multi-award-winning electric crossover that redefined the brand's image, offering a futuristic design balanced with 800V ultra-fast charging capabilities. Since its 2021 launch, it has become a top contender for UK motorists looking for a premium alternatives to the Tesla Model Y or Hyundai Ioniq 5, combining a spacious cabin with an impressive real-world range over 300 miles.

Why Buy a Used Kia EV6?

  • Ultra-fast 800V charging allows a 10% to 80% top-up in just 18 minutes at compatible 350kW DC chargers.
  • A generous 7-year/100,000-mile warranty provides long-term peace of mind and is fully transferable to subsequent owners via the V5C.
  • ULEZ compliance is guaranteed across all models, making it an ideal choice for commuting into London and other UK Clean Air Zones without daily charges.
  • The 450-litre boot and flat interior floor make it a highly practical family car that doesn't compromise on rear passenger legroom.

Common Issues to Check

  • 12V Battery Drainage: Some owners have reported the auxiliary 12V battery failing, often linked to frequent use of the Kia Connect app while the car is parked.
  • ICCU Failure: A known issue involving the Integrated Charging Control Unit which may lead to a loss of power; check if the DVLA recall work has been performed.
  • Internal Rattles: Early production models sometimes suffer from minor trim rattles around the dashboard and rear parcel shelf.
  • Eco-Tyre Wear: The significant weight and high torque can lead to accelerated wear on the front tyres if the car is driven aggressively.

Running Costs

  • Fuel Economy: Up to 328 miles (WLTP combined) using the 77.4kWh battery pack.
  • Insurance Group: 34 to 46, with the high-performance GT sitting at the top of the scale.
  • Servicing: Intervals are every 20,000 miles or 24 months. Expect to pay £200–£400 for standard inspections plus MOT costs once the car is three years old.

Which Variant Should I Choose?

  • Air: Value-conscious buyers who want the maximum range from the 77.4kWh battery without the premium price of larger wheels and sporty styling.
  • GT-Line: The sweet spot for most UK buyers, offering sportier body styling, vegan leather upholstery, and privacy glass.
  • GT-Line S: Tech enthusiasts who want the sunroof, Meridian premium sound system, Hunt-up Display (HUD), and 20-inch alloy wheels.
  • GT: Performance seekers looking for supercar-baiting 0-62mph times of 3.5 seconds and specialized 'GT' drive modes, though at the cost of some driving range.
